Eskom Holdings SOC Limited has appointed NTC Group (Pty) Ltd as an independent Environmental Consultants to undertake a Basic Assessment Process for the proposed construction of the Borutho-Silimela 400kV power line and its associated infrastructure. The length of the power line is approximately 150km. The proposed power line is located between the Borutho Substation on farm Gillimberg 861 in Mokopane and runs south to the proposed Silimela substation on farm Loskop Noord 12, near Marble Hall within the Lepelle-Nkumpi, Mogalakwena, Modimolle-Mookgophong and Ephriam Mogale Local Municipalities, Limpopo Province. The construction of the power line will aid Eskom in strengthening the power supply within Limpopo Province.The scope of work entails:
Extend Borutho Substation to accommodate 1 x 400kV feeder bay for Silimela Line 1
Extend Silimela Substation to accommodate 1 x 400kV feeder bay for Borutho Line 1
Build approximately 150km 400kV line from Borutho Substation to Silimela Substation, with associated extensions at the terminal substations.
